Roger W. Fowler, passed away September

3, 2021, in Jacksonvil­le,

FL. He was 82.

He was born in Columbus,

Ohio to Virginia Margaret (Gaitten) and Charles

George Fowler. He enlisted in the Marine Corps and served honorably for 8 years. Roger had initially visited Amelia Island while serving in the Marine Corps at NAS Jacksonvil­le. He and his wife Susan fell in love with Amelia Island after visiting in the 1980s and made their home on the island in 1990. Their mutual love of travel took them to

Okinawa, Japan for 8 years and Stuttgart, Germany for 9 years. Roger and Susan traveled extensivel­y in Asia and across Europe. He was an Electronic Technician for the US Air Force and retired after 30 combined years of Federal Service at

Newark Air Force Station,

Ohio and Kadena Air Base,

Japan. Roger was an active member of the United

States Coast Guard Auxiliary

Flotilla 14-1 on Amelia

Island and retired after serving as Operations Staff

Officer for several years. He is survived by his wife of 37 years, Susan (Mccoy) Fowler;
